Many nurses are choosing to work in other countries, providing an opportunity to broaden their experience and knowledge. However, it is important that nurses who have the opportunity to work overseas develop cultural awareness and sensitivity before arriving. This article provides a reflective account of the experiences of one of the authors of working overseas. From the reflective account and evidence available in the literature on cultural sensitivity, insights are offered to nurses who may be considering working overseas to ensure they are adequately prepared.
